Qualifications/Experience:
Current Minnesota Special Ed license in ASD SLD or EBD.
Successful background check required.
Knowledge/Skills/Abilities Needed:
Thorough knowledge of the principles and methodology of effective teaching; ability to establish and maintain standards of behavior; ability to deliver articulate oral presentations and written reports; and 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with staff students and parents. Calm demeanor and passion for working with kids.Ability to communicate effectively with school staff and parents.
Exemplifies the following Five Character Traits: compassion respect responsibility self discipline and honesty.
Specific Tasks:
Provide special education services to students. The teacher will work closely with teachers admin and support staff to teach students skills and strategies for managing behaviors and working towards using strategies in the mainstream setting. Provide an ideal positive learning environment instruct students in individual or group sessions develop translate and integrate lesson plans and establish positive relationships.
